- [ ] **Step 7: Breaker override escrow.** After sealing the signing keys for the Tallgrove upstream API circuit breaker, confirm the support team can force the breaker open during a full outage. The override bundle lives in the sealed escrow drawer and is useless without its unlock phrase. Two ceremony witnesses must initial this step before proceeding. The escrow bundle is decrypted with the recovery passphrase that follows.

vault phrase of kahip-kahop = holath-quenmir

Hey, welcome to on-call for Ledgerline! Quick context: the events table is partitioned by month, and a cron job creates next month's partition on the 25th. When that job fails (it happens), inserts start erroring right at midnight on the 1st — fun times. The runbook has the manual `CREATE PARTITION` steps. To run them, you'll connect to the primary with the connection string below.

database URL for hafog-yahip: clickhouse://rusir_svc:LpcRMav@db-3230.norvaforge.example:5432/gorir

## Handover: Cron → Weftrunner Migration

For review: this branch moves the last six cron jobs (report generation, cache warmup, four cleanup tasks) into Weftrunner workflows. Each workflow keeps the original schedule but adds retries and alerting, which the crons never had. The old crontab entries are commented out, not deleted — we remove them after one clean week. Watch for the cache-warmup workflow; it's the only one with a dependency edge. To verify locally, start the Weftrunner scheduler with the following configuration values.

service settings:
[casax]
port = 6379
team = rusir
host = casax.zemvarhq.corp
region = outer-4
access_code = ac_9808ce
timeout_ms = 1500